Jackson County opens cold weather warming station
Jackson County Emergency Operations Center said in a Facebook post that a cold weather warming station is now available at the Jackson County Fairgrounds, 2902 Shortcut Road in Pascagoula.
The facility will be open Monday, Tuesday and Wednesday evenings from 5 p.m. to 8 a.m. Ocean Springs residents who need assistance or transportation to the shelter are asked to contact the Ocean Springs Police Department at 228-875-2211. Transportation will be provided to anyone who needs it, the post said.
